 * It says:
    “Grab the header
 * In order to transform regular PHP pages into ones that utilize WordPress, you
   need to add either of the following code snippets to the start of each page.”
 *     ```
       <?php
       /* Short and sweet */
       define('WP_USE_THEMES', false);
       require('./wp-blog-header.php');
       ?>
       ```
   
 *     ```
       <?php
       require('/the/path/to/your/wp-blog-header.php');
       ?>
       ```
   
 * Do I have to put the above code in every single PHP page I have? I think I know
   the answer but I want to make sure 🙂
